It has been announced that Iroha Okuda of the idol group Nogizaka46 will be making a guest appearance on the 25th episode of the musical program "Live Broadcast! Yoshio Inoue Musical Hour 'Yoshio's Mu'," which will be broadcast and streamed live on WOWOW on September 17th. This time, the theme is "Moon Viewing," and the show is titled "Moon Viewing Night Party," and in addition to Okuda, actors Ryunosuke Onoda, Takuji Kawakubo, and Taisei Shima will also be making guest appearances. This will be the first time the four have appeared on "Yoshio's Mu," and it will also be their first time acting together.
On the show, the performers will be dressed in autumnal attire, and will be talking and singing in jinbei and yukata.
Okuda is a member of Nogizaka46, and won the role of Juliet in the musical "Romeo & Juliet," which was performed from May to July 2024, making it her stage debut and her first musical appearance. She then appeared as Olympe in the musical "1789 - Lovers of the Bastille," which was performed from April to May 2025. This will be her first time acting alongside Yoshio Inoue, who serves as the program's MC.
Onoda began dancing as a child and has continued to gain stage experience, appearing in numerous musicals to date. Her major musical appearances include "West Side Story," "Miss Saigon," "Mary Poppins," "West Side Story," "Fist of the North Star," "Les Miserables," "Matilda," and "Peter Pan." She has also co-starred with Inoue in "Rudolf: The Last Kiss," "Mozart!," and "Beethoven."
Kawakubo made his acting debut in 2003, and gained popularity for his starring role in "Ultraman Nexus," which aired from 2004 to 2005. He is currently active mainly in TV dramas, films, stage plays, and commercials. He has co-starred with Inoue on the WOWOW musical comedy program "Green & Blacks" many times. His major musical appearances include "Romeo & Juliet," "Indigo Tomato," "Little Women," "Magi: The Labyrinth Suite," "DADDY," "Colorful," and "Groundhog Day."
Shima is a member of the boys' group NORD and also works as a musical actor, having received high praise for his role as Henri Dupre/The Monster in the musical Frankenstein, which was performed from April to May 2025. He will appear as Watari Ryota in the musical Your Lie in April, which opens on August 23rd. His main musical appearances include Loserville, A Silent Voice, and Girlfriend.
The 25th episode of "Yoshio's Mu" will be broadcast and streamed live on WOWOW Live and WOWOW On Demand from 10:00 p.m. on September 17th.
